[0014] Embodiment: add the desulfurizer limestone powder of particle size 1mm~3mm from the car unloading ditch, the weight ratio of coal and limestone powder is 10~12: 1, concrete process is as follows:

[0015] Vehicle unloading ditch——Impeller coal feeder——Level 1 coal conveying belt——Level 2 coal conveying belt——Third stage coal conveying belt——Coal crusher——Level 4 coal conveying belt——Fifth stage coal conveying belt ——Six-level coal conveying belt——Raw coal bucket.

[0016] After the desulfurizer limestone powder comes out of the raw coal hopper, the specific process is as follows:

[0017] Raw coal hopper - primary coal feeder - secondary coal feeder - boiler furnace

[0018] Due to the large particle size of limestone powder, it is not easy to be blown away by high-pressure wind in the boiler furnace, and it can be mixed evenly with coal particles, and it can be mixed with coal particles repeatedly during the transportation process, and the mixing effect is good. The invention belongs to limestone addition method for improving desulfuration efficiency of circular fluidized bed boiler, and in particular relates to an addition method of desulfurizer limestone. The method is implemented by regulating granularity of limestone powder to below 1-3mm, pouring limestone powder into a coal unloading ditch with weight ratio of coal to limestone powder being 10-12:1, after mixing with coal in the coal unloading ditch, mixing the limestone powder and the coal by a paddle coal feeder at the bottom of the coal unloading ditch, conveying by a coal conveying belt anda forwarding station to further mix the coal and the limestone powder uniformly and conveying into a raw coal bunker, mixing the mixture of coal and limestone powder coming out of the raw coal bunkeragain by a secondary coal feeder, and conveying into the hearth of the boiler to react with sulfur dioxide gas in fume. The method overcomes the defects that conveying by the original limestone powder pipeline is difficult, the limestone powder is easy to blown away due to light weight and the abrasion of the pipeline is great, prolongs retention period in the boiler, improves desulfuration efficiency, reduces sulfur dioxide emission, has simple operation without replacing the original design and is an efficient replacement to the original system.

technical field [0001] The invention belongs to a limestone adding method for improving desulfurization efficiency of a circulating fluidized bed boiler, in particular to a limestone adding method for a desulfurizing agent. Background technique: [0002] Circulating fluidized bed combustion technology is a high-efficiency, low-pollution clean coal combustion technology developed in the past 20 years. Due to its wide fuel adaptability, high combustion efficiency, efficient desulfurization, NO X It has been developed rapidly due to the advantages of low emission, high section heat load, large load adjustment ratio and fast load adjustment. With the continuous improvement of environmental protection requirements, some corresponding technical solutions for circulating fluidized bed boiler desulfurization have appeared in recent years.
